Output fe69eb4a6009cf1a45402942695c9bf5bd8efc1064af8fb80e67fdf8914e93c1:1

value
89669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dde1e0c2dd6faab3888785116d4ffd61b7bf50 OP_EQUAL
address
3FMSQnH4MTgxh67Ky7NUweUjdzjRyrNkMh
transaction
fe69eb4a6009cf1a45402942695c9bf5bd8efc1064af8fb80e67fdf8914e93c1
confirmations
318768
spent
true